Description Sanrei
Gladiolus variety Golden Sanray, also known as Sanrey, is a bright and sunny flower with a rich yellow coloration that gives it a special elegance and warmth. The plant reaches a height of 70-80 cm and forms voluminous spike-like inflorescences up to 50 cm long, consisting of 15-20 funnel-shaped flowers with a diameter of 7-8 cm. This variety is compact, allowing it to be grown without staking during blooming, and its bright color hardly fades in sunlight, maintaining its vibrant shades for a long time.

Gladiolus Golden Sanray blooms from July to August, delighting the eye with abundant and prolonged flowering. The first buds appear as early as mid-summer, making this variety especially attractive for creating colorful and eye-catching floral compositions. Thanks to its bright yellow palette, it is ideal for cutting and creating elegant bouquets, as well as for decorating flowerbeds, where it harmoniously combines with other plants to create interesting design solutions.

For successful cultivation of Sanrey gladiolus, it is recommended to plant it in nutrient-rich, moist loamy-sandy soils. The plant prefers sunny locations and requires digging up and storing the corms until planting. This variety will be a true find for lovers of bright and striking flowers capable of decorating any garden and interior.
